How Much Does a Cabana Rental Cost?
Cabanas start at $69 on weekdays, with seasonal weekend and holiday pricing. We frequently run promos like Sunday Funday with $69 cabanas all day — check the banner at the top of the site for current deals. Pricing varies by property, day of week, and season.
What's Included With Every Cabana Rental?
- Up to 6 guests per cabana
- 1 free parking spot per cabana
- Picnic table at your cabana
- Direct river access from your spot — float right from the cabana
- Shaded covered structure on the Guadalupe River
- Access to on-site restrooms and friendly staff
- A calm, family-friendly atmosphere
What's NOT Included (and Common Add-Ons)
A cabana rental is your basecamp — most guests add tubes, kayaks, or extras. Here's what to think about:
- Tube rental — starting at $29.99 for all-day tubing
- Kayak rental — available on most properties
- Extra parking — additional vehicles are a small per-car fee
- Food & drinks — bring your own coolers (no glass)
- Overnight stays — pair with glamping near New Braunfels or tent camping on River Road
How Many People Fit in a Cabana?
Each cabana is built for up to 6 guests. Bigger group? Book multiple cabanas side by side, or call our team and we'll help you set up a group reservation across our properties. We host birthday parties, bachelorette weekends, family reunions, and corporate days all the time.
